The Bull Hotel in Wrotham feels very cosy on entering
and the original oak beams and an inglenook fireplace add to the atmosphere. We were greeted and shown to our table
by very friendly and attentive staff, all of whom had an exact knowledge of both the menu and wine list and are a great asset
to the establishment. The atmosphere in the restaurant was very relaxed and I enjoyed the pleasant music playing in
the background.
For my starter I chose the garlic tiger prawns (£6.50) that were very well presented, and this was accompanied
by Martin’s suggested 2006 delicate crisp and aromatic dry white wine. This provided a perfect start for my meal.
The main course was smoked haddock poached in cream, accompanied by spinach mash with poached egg (£14). It was
delicious and cooked to perfection.
My
guest Paul (my husband!) enjoyed his starter which was the oaked smoked trout, accompanied with horseradish crème fraiche,
salad and bread (£5.50). For his main course he chose Hartley Bottom fillet with chive & black peppercorn
butter, herb salad and hand cut chips (£24). To accompany this choice, Martin suggested the French 2001 Opulens
Red. To finish the meal we enjoyed two of Martin & Lygia’s popular desserts very much. The Moist Orange
cake with citrus crème fraiche and the strawberry and balsamic vinegar sorbet were both delicious. Thee cheese
board could not be missed though, with a wonderful range of both local and French produce.
I highly recommend The Bull, as I was delighted with all aspects including location, service
and quality of food. It certainly combines great taste with fantastic value for money. Definitely not to be missed!
